What

I got this app because it looked so simple and easy to use, and it was for the first week. It gave me the free trial right up front and said that I didn’t have to worry about it charging me automatically after it was over, so that was also really nice. The layout is great and I really liked it, except for one major thing. You have to get the premium to be able to record your days! That, to me, seems very strange and was not made clear anywhere. When you click on the premium trial thing, it says it removes ads, you get a free theme and advanced stats, and so forth, but it doesn’t say anywhere that you have to get the premium pass to be able to record more than seven days worth. Without the pass, you have to watch an ad to record your day, which would be fine except you have to do that every single day and seeing as how this is a mental health help app, that seems a bit off-beat. Would recommend, if you pay or don’t mind ads, but otherwise it is useless.

Good, can still improve, give us ONE TIME PURCHASE

First of all, out of all the "self care tracking" apps I've used this is the easiest one. It's really simple, doesn't take too long to enter a day and it's relatively straight forward. You can filter by the icons you've assigned to different things, for example if you want to see how many times you've socialized with friends over the past few weeks, you can make it display that rather quickly. So that's cool and all but I still think the app could use some improvements: 1. The bean color is not colorblind friendly, regardless if you purchase a pack or not, they are all greenish or pinkish, we should be able to customize their colors to make them more distinguishable (give us a color slider or something because the little faces aren't enough in my opinion). 2. The ads pop up after you log a day and if you don't watch it, the day won't save, which is kinda greedy. I don't mind the ads that much because they're quick and the app is free but I wish there were a one time purchase price for the premium features, no way am I paying monthly for what this app currently has to offer. All in all, I'm still going to use this but it could be better.

Description

DailyBean is a simple diary app for those who want to record their daily lives easily. Record your day with just a few tabs! DailyBean provides these functions. ○ Monthly calendar that gives you a glimpse of your mood flow Take a look at how you feel during a month with five mood beans.

If you click on the bean, you can check the record you left that day right away. ○ Tap the mood beans and activity icons for a simple record Let's choose your mood for the day and summarize the day with colorful icons. You can add a picture and a line of notes. ○ Category blocks that allow you to select only the categories you want Blocks can be added or deleted whenever you want, and categories will be updated continuously. ○ Statistics that analyze mood and activity on a weekly/monthly basis Look at your mood flow through statistics and see what activities affect your mood. You can also check the number of icon records on a weekly and monthly basis. If you have any questions or inconveniences while using the app, please contact us here!
